As I look to fulfill my campaign priorities, it must be done in the midst of the worst economic times since the great depression. I am, however, optimistic that we will pull out of this time of challenge, and look forward to being part of it.

My campaign commitment to support education has resulted to my co-sponsorship of many important bills at the primary and secondary education level, such as legislation to allow additional criteria along with the MCAS test score to be considered as a condition for graduation.

I have supported several healthcare initiatives to help people with affordable healthcare, including legislation to help Sturdy Memorial Hospital to remain competitive.

Public Safety is an important priority, and I have worked closely with local and statewide Fire and Police to support legislation/funding to preserve public safety.

During these very difficult times, I have worked closely with Mayor Dumas and the State Legislature to help Attleboro obtain as much local aid as possible. I have worked closely with Mayor Dumas and State Officials to help with our Downtown Revitalization Project and the Industrial Business Park.
